Sucha [ˈsuxa] (German: Zauche) is a district of the city of Zielona Góra, in western Poland,[1] located in the southeastern part of the city. It was a separate village until 2014.
Sucha has a population of 300.
There is a historic Neoclassical Saint Martin church in Sucha.
